How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Kitsap County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Kitsap County Studio Apartments | $1,694 | $1,000 | $2,149 |
| Kitsap County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,898 | $1,089 | $2,835 |
| Kitsap County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,271 | $1,192 | $4,550 |
| Kitsap County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,506 | $1,204 | $3,550 |
| Kitsap County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,136 | $2,073 | $4,200 |
